次の方法で共有


Range.AllowEdit プロパティ (Excel)

保護されたワークシートで指定された範囲が編集可能かどうかを表すブール型 (Boolean) の値を返します。

構文

AllowEdit

expressionRange オブジェクトを表す変数です。

この例では、Microsoft Excel は、保護されたワークシートでセル A1 を編集できるかどうかをユーザーに通知します。

Sub UseAllowEdit() 
 
 Dim wksOne As Worksheet 
 
 Set wksOne = Application.ActiveSheet 
 
 ' Protect the worksheet 
 wksOne.Protect 
 
 ' Notify the user about editing cell A1. 
 If wksOne.Range("A1").AllowEdit = True Then 
 MsgBox "Cell A1 can be edited." 
 Else 
 Msgbox "Cell A1 cannot be edited." 
 End If 
 
End Sub

サポートとフィードバック

Office VBA またはこの説明書に関するご質問やフィードバックがありますか? サポートの受け方およびフィードバックをお寄せいただく方法のガイダンスについては、Office VBA のサポートおよびフィードバックを参照してください。